What are Dental Braces?

Orthodontic treatment commonly uses braces, a specialized device consist of brackets, bands, and wires that work together to gradually align teeth. This approach effectively addresses a variety of dental issues, including misalignment, crowding, gaps, and bite problems such as overbite, underbite, and malocclusion.

We offer many types of braces in Liberty Township, including traditional metal braces featuring visible brackets, ceramic braces that are designed to be less conspicuous and blend with the natural tooth color, and Invisalign, which offers a clear, removable alternative.

The length of treatment typically varies from one to three years, during which an orthodontist performs regular adjustments to tighten the wires, replace the elastics, and make adjustments to the brackets.

Once the braces are removed, wearing retainers becomes essential to ensure the newly positioned teeth remain stable.

Metal braces are essential for improving oral health by addressing various dental challenges, including misaligned teeth, overbites, underbites, improper jaw positioning, and jaw joint disorders. In addition to achieving correct teeth alignment, braces promote healthier gums, facilitate better oral hygiene, and help prevent cavities, gum disease, and tooth loss. They also ensure an even distribution of biting forces, which reduces the risk of tooth damage.

From a cosmetic standpoint, metal braces help create a more appealing smile, enhance facial symmetry, and boost self-confidence. FAQ

Are braces suitable for all age groups?

Traditional braces are indeed appropriate for a wide range of ages. They are most frequently linked with kids and teenagers, as orthodontic treatment usually starts during these developmental years. However, it’s important to recognize that adults can also take advantage of traditional braces. Recently, there has been a notable increase in adults pursuing orthodontic care, illustrating that it’s always possible to correct dental alignment problems later in life. Still, the suitability of traditional braces depends on individual conditions, so it is recommended that people consult with an orthodontic professional to find the best treatment plan for their specific needs.

How long does the braces treatment typically take?

The length of braces treatment differs based on factors like the severity of the issue, the kind of braces used, and the patient’s unique response to care. Typically, treatment may last from several months to a few years. Do braces cause discomfort or pain?

Traditional braces are quite effective in addressing dental misalignments, but they may lead to discomfort or pain, especially during the early phase of application and during adjustment appointments. The force applied to the teeth as they are gradually repositioned can lead to mild to moderate soreness, usually subsiding after a few days. Moreover, the physical brackets may irritate the soft tissues inside the mouth. It’s essential to recognize that these sensations are typical aspects of orthodontic treatment and can be alleviated with over-the-counter pain medications and dental wax. Routine visits to the orthodontist can also help mitigate any discomfort experienced during the process.
